当我们想要执行对屏幕对象的操作的时候,一般第一想法就是用LOOP AT SCREEN,但是对于SELECT-OPTION创建的对象,在取SCREEN-NAME字段的时候会有一些问题,
比如我想要取S_YCINO这个字段,但是因为SELECT-OPTION定义的问题,取到的只能是下面的字段


所以用LOOP AT SCREEN就不太方便了,
我们直接使用SELECT-OPTION的属性设置,增加NO-DISPLAY控制选择屏幕字段的显示与隐藏就可以了。
本文探讨了在ABAP编程中,当使用LOOPATSCREEN操作屏幕对象遇到SELECT-OPTIONS创建的对象时的问题。特别关注了如何通过设置SELECT-OPTIONS的属性来控制选择屏幕字段的显示与隐藏,提供了一种更有效的解决方案。
当我们想要执行对屏幕对象的操作的时候,一般第一想法就是用LOOP AT SCREEN,但是对于SELECT-OPTION创建的对象,在取SCREEN-NAME字段的时候会有一些问题,
比如我想要取S_YCINO这个字段,但是因为SELECT-OPTION定义的问题,取到的只能是下面的字段


所以用LOOP AT SCREEN就不太方便了,
我们直接使用SELECT-OPTION的属性设置,增加NO-DISPLAY控制选择屏幕字段的显示与隐藏就可以了。
2529
2046

被折叠的 条评论
为什么被折叠?